Democrats begin pulling Platner endorsements after Maine candidate faces sexual assault allegation
By Kimberlee Kruesi, Associated Press at KPRC 2 / Click2Houston (NBC)
· July 6, 2026
· 3 min read
A woman who previously dated Maine Democratic Senate candidate Graham Platner said he drunkenly forced her to have sex after she told him to stop, according to a Politico report released Monday, leading prominent supporters to pull their endorsements and throwing a must-win race for the party int...
Key takeaway Jenny Racicot, who lives in Maine, told Politico that Platner entered her home in 2021 while drunk and assaulted her.
